In this short video, I demonstrate the hydrocarbon cut solvent test on a St. Louis Dolomite sample from the southern region of the Illinois basin. This test helps assess a rock's potential to yield commercially viable hydrocarbons. #oil&gas #illinoisbasin #geology #hydrocarboncutsolventtest
